Summer reading challenge

On the 4th and 5th July children were introduced to Derbyshire's summer reading challenge in our assembly. More information is available on the Derbyshire website. CLICK HERE. 

This summer children are being challenged to read six books from their local library, Belper library by Morrisons supermarket is taking part. 

 

For every book your child reads this summer they will get a sticker, when they have read 6 books they will get a certificate and a medal. 

 

The launch event is at Belper library on Saturday 16th July when children are invited to join in with free events and activities. This summer the reading challenge is themed around Science and Technology and throughout the day on the 16th July Belper library will have free activities for your children to do based on the Gadgeteers. Children don't have to attend the launch event, they can pick up their sticker chart and first book at any time.
